A276118 Numbers k such that 42 * 10^k + 1 is prime.

Original entry on oeis.org

0, 1, 2, 4, 13, 19, 39, 62, 76, 79, 109, 184, 222, 265, 370, 626, 670, 679, 763, 1950, 2174, 3379, 7369, 9087, 34990, 47535, 97970
Offset: 1

Comments

For k > 0, numbers k such that the digits 42 followed by k - 1 occurrences of the digit 0 followed by the digit 1 is prime (see the Example section).
a(28) > 10^5.

Examples

			4 is in this sequence because 42*10^4+1 = 420001 is prime.
Initial terms and associated primes:
a(1) = 0, 43;
a(2) = 1, 421;
a(3) = 2, 4201;
a(4) = 4, 420001;
a(5) = 13, 420000000000001, etc.

Programs

  • Mathematica
    Select[Range[0, 100000], PrimeQ[42 * 10^# + 1] &]
  • PARI
    is(n)=ispseudoprime(42*10^n+1) \\ Charles R Greathouse IV, Jun 13 2017
